

Richard grew up in Saginaw, Michigan and San Antonio, Texas. He graduated from Parks Aeronautical College in E. St. Louis, Illionios in 1952. That year he also met the love of his life, Marilyn Eales. They were married on February 7, 1953. They would be the parents of six children: Linda O'Brien Dan, Mary Heaston Mike, Kathleen Sexson, Rick Mudd Jennifer, Robert Mudd Kimi, and Jennifer Streater. There are 11 grandchildren as well.
Richard was a fighter pilot for the Air Force during the Korean conflict. After leaving the service he was an entrepreneur in a number of business adventures, finally finding his niche as a consummate salesman.
His favorite hobbies were building model airplanes and a lifelong love of planes, metal detecting and the selling of his treasures. He was a devote Catholic and a member of St. Mark the Evangelist parish. He was a beloved neighbor and friend and will be missed by them as well as his family.
He was preceded in death by only a month by his wife of 56 years; they are now in eternity together.
